On the institution side, Guangdong University of Foreign Studies is connected to scholarships that can reduce tuition and sometimes extend to other study costs. These are practical starting points. Excellent New Language Student Scholarships is commonly categorized as full tuition support, and coverage that often includes 50% to 100% of tuition fees. With Excellent New Degree Student Scholarship, students may receive full tuition support, and coverage frequently includes 50% or 100% tuition fee waiver.
Beyond campus funding, Guangdong University of Foreign Studies applicants often explore outside opportunities including government backed and independent programs. These are common starting points. Chinese Government Scholarship is usually considered fully funded, and typical coverage can include tuition fees, accommodation fees, and CNY 2,500 per month for undergraduate and CNY 3,000 for Master's and CNY 3,500 for Ph.D. students. A strong option is Guangdong Government Outstanding Foreign Student Scholarship which is partially funded and often covers RMB 10,000 for bachelor's, RMB 20,000 for master's, and RMB 30,000 for Ph.D. students.
